four hundred ninety-nine million, nine hundred ninety-one thousand, three hundred forty-four
Currency CA$499991344 in canadian english: four hundred ninety-nine million, nine hundred ninety-one thousand, three hundred forty-four Canadian dollar.
In Price: 499991344.00
489991344 | 509991344